This easy crochet top pattern is perfect for beginners and experienced crafters alike, offering a stylish, versatile piece you can wear all year round. Using double knitting yarn and a 4mm crochet hook, this pattern comes in three sizes, making it adaptable to a range of body types.

Materials
- Double knitting yarn
- 4mm crochet hook
- Yarn in your preferred color (two balls for medium size)
Sizing
- Small: 136 chains (approx. 80 cm or 31.5 inches)
- Medium: 142 chains (approx. 86 cm or 34 inches)
- Large: 148 chains (approx. 92 cm or 36 inches)
Foundation Chain
- Start with a slip knot and chain the required number of stitches based on your size.
- For Medium: 142 chains (86 cm or 34 inches)
- For Small: 136 chains (80 cm or 31.5 inches)
- For Large: 148 chains (92 cm or 36 inches)
Row 1: Double Crochet
- Turn the chain to the back.
- Skip the first three chains and make a double crochet into the fourth chain.
- Continue making one double crochet in each chain across the row.
Row 2: Half Double Crochet
- Chain two and turn your work.
- Skip the next double crochet and make one half double crochet into the next stitch.
- Go back and make one half double crochet into the skipped stitch.
- Repeat this pattern across the row.
For Row 3: Double Crochet (Back Loop Only)
- Chain three and turn your work.
- Make one double crochet in each stitch, using only the back loop.
Repeating the Pattern
- Repeat Row 2 and Row 3.
- Small: 17 rows
- Medium: 21 rows
- Large: 25 rows
Creating the Neck Opening
- Mark the stitches for the neck opening. For medium, mark 33 double crochets on each side for the shoulder/sleeve area, leaving 74 stitches for the neck opening.
- Continue the pattern (Row 2) up to the first stitch marker.
- Chain 74 stitches for the neck opening.
- Join to the next stitch marker and continue the pattern (Row 2) to the end of the row.
- In the next row (Row 3), work one double crochet in each stitch, including each of the 74 chains for the neck.
Finishing the Top
- Once you have completed the required number of rows, cut the yarn and knot it.
- Join the two sides together using a needle, sewing through the back loop of each stitch. Leave an opening for the sleeves (approx. 23 cm or 9 inches for medium size).
- Finish the neckline and sleeves with slip stitches or single crochet. The video creator used five rounds of slip stitches around the neck for a neater look.
